Richmond Hill’s 21st Annual Christmas Parade: “Christmas Around the World”
Saturday, December 3, 2016
10 a.m.
This year’s parade, which will celebrate Christmas around the world, will feature several local high school bands, Ft. Stewart 3rd Infantry Division Marching Band and Color Guard and the Alee Shriners. There will be a special appearance by Santa Claus and candy for children. The parade route will begin on Maple Street, continue on Cherry Street, down Ford Avenue, make a right turn into Richard Davis Dr. and continue onto Cedar Street before making its conclusion in J.F. Gregory Park.
